Airports in Bangkok
Bangkok Suvarnabhumi International Airport (BKK)
Bangkok Suvarnabhumi International Airport (BKK) is around 31 kilometers from the center of Bangkok. If you're catching a cab or a ride-share, the drive takes about 35 minutes.
Getting to the center by public transport will take you around 35 minutes.

Bangkok Don Mueang International Airport (DMK)
Central Bangkok is about 24 kilometers from Bangkok Don Mueang International Airport (DMK). Once your flight from Frederick Douglass Greater Rochester Intl Airport to Bangkok has hit the runway and you've made your way through the terminal, expect a drive of about 35 minutes.
If you travel by public transport, the journey will take you 1 hour 5 minutes or so.

Best time to go to Bangkok
It's time to pick your trip dates for your flight from Frederick Douglass Greater Rochester Intl Airport to Bangkok. February is the most popular month to travel to Bangkok. If you prefer a more relaxed atmosphere, go in May.
Before booking a Frederick Douglass Greater Rochester Intl Airport to Bangkok plane ticket, think about the kind of weather forecast you're hoping for. April is the warmest month in Bangkok, with temperatures ranging from 26ºC (79ºF) to 37ºC (99ºF).
If you like traveling in cooler conditions, search for a cheap ticket from ROC to Bangkok in January when temperatures average between 19ºC (66ºF) and 34ºC (93ºF).
